Groq vs Fireworks AI — Comparison

The Bottom Line

Groq excels in delivering fast and cost-efficient inference, ideal for large-scale AI applications, while Fireworks AI offers more diverse features with a higher average user rating of 4.5/5 on G2, yet lacks detailed user discussions. Groq's community engagement appears minimal, focusing on practical integrations, whereas Fireworks AI provides broader use cases like conversational AI and multimedia processing, despite less distinct social presence.

Best for

Groq is the better choice when fast model inference and cost optimization are crucial for teams dealing with industry-standard frameworks and integrations.

Best for

Fireworks AI is the better choice when diverse AI functionalities like code assistance and customer support automation are needed by smaller teams looking for lower entry costs.

Key Differences

  • 1.Groq primarily focuses on fast, cost-efficient LLM inference with tiered pricing ranging from $0.075 to $1, while Fireworks AI offers features such as code assistance at starting prices from $0.008 to $1.
  • 2.Groq supports popular providers such as OpenAI, Google Cloud, and AWS Lambdas with integration in Kubernetes, whereas Fireworks AI integrates with productivity tools like Slack, Trello, and Jira.
  • 3.Fireworks AI has a user rating disparity (4.5/5 vs. 3/5) on G2, indicating varying levels of user satisfaction, while Groq lacks substantial user reviews.
  • 4.With a venture funding of $3.3B, Groq has a significantly larger financial backing compared to Fireworks AI's $332M in Series C funding.
  • 5.Fireworks AI's use cases are more varied, including real-time text and vision workflows, while Groq focuses on efficient model runtime without detailed user feedback.
  • 6.Groq's employee base is over four times larger than Fireworks AI's, potentially allowing for broader service and integration capabilities.

Verdict

Groq is better suited for organizations prioritizing LLM inference speed and cost, particularly those leveraging established frameworks. In contrast, Fireworks AI appeals to teams seeking varied functionality such as enterprise summarization and code debugging, with potential budget considerations. Both tools have their unique strengths, serving different needs in the AI development landscape.

Lessons from building a coding agent for 8k context windows: token budgeting, parallel executors, and per-file isolation

Most AI coding tools (Cursor, Aider, Claude Code) assume you have a 200k-token model. If you're running local LLMs through Ollama or LM Studio, or hitting free-tier cloud APIs like Groq or OpenRouter, you've got around 8k tokens to work with.
